Key features of the best shirts for embroidery
Before choosing your next blank, learn what makes some t-shirts better for embroidery than others.
For machine embroidery, the safest embroidery blanks have a stable knit, a smooth surface, and enough structure to hold stitches without puckering.
Let’s quickly look at the key features that determine how your stitches will look and last.
Shirt material
The fabric is the foundation of any good embroidered t-shirt. The best results come from natural materials like 100% cotton or cotton-poly blends, which are tightly woven and durable enough to hold each stitch in place.
These shirts feel soft yet structured, making them ideal for clean stitching, detailed embroidery, and small left-chest logos.
For t-shirts, look for combed cotton, ring-spun cotton, cotton-poly blends, or other stable fabrics that allow the needle to move cleanly through the garment.
Avoid slick synthetics and heavily textured fabrics, since they can shift under the hoop, hide small details, or make an embroidered logo look uneven after a wash.
Fabric weight
Fabric weight refers to how heavy or thick a shirt feels. A medium-weight or heavier tee (usually 5 oz and above) offers the best results, keeping the embroidery secure and preventing puckering.
The best quality t-shirts for embroidery usually have enough weight to support the thread, stabilizer, and repeated stitches without stretching the artwork out of shape.
Lightweight t-shirts can still work for screen printing, but might not be the best shirts for embroidery. Threads add density, so the fabric has to carry more weight.
Design limitations
While modern embroidery techniques handle a wide range of designs, there are still some practical limits. Overly intricate details, small text, or large, full-color graphics can be tricky to embroider cleanly.
Instead, focus on simple designs with clear lines, bold contrasts, and enough spacing around small text. That combo gives you crisp stitching instead of turning into a crowded patch of thread. If your design leans toward more color or fine detail, screen printing might handle it better than heavy stitching.

Standard embroidery

Standard embroidery, also called classic embroidery, uses needle-and-thread stitching to embroider your designs directly into the fabric.
This is the most popular choice and works best for embroidery with logos, text, simple designs, polos, hats, and t-shirts that need a clean, textured finish.
Choose from 15 thread colors, with up to six colors per design, for a polished look that lasts wash after wash.
Use standard embroidery when your artwork needs clear lines, solid shapes, and a professional finish.

Unlimited-color embroidery

Unlimited-color embroidery is ideal for complex embroidery designs, multi-shade gradients, and modern branding with more depth.
The technique uses one white recycled polyester thread that’s dyed mid-stitch, so there are no thread swaps, hoop resets, or traditional color limits.

Yes, when the fabric is stable enough to hold stitches. T-shirts, polos, sweatshirts, tank tops, and some work shirts can all work. The best results come from medium-weight or heavier garments with a smooth surface. Avoid overly thin, slick, or stretchy fabrics that can distort the design.
Cotton, cotton-poly blends, pique, and thicker jersey fabrics are usually best for embroidery. Apparel made from these materials holds the stabilizer, needle, and thread better than thin or slippery materials do.
For the best t-shirts for embroidery, look for a smooth surface, durable construction, and enough weight to support stitches without puckering after wear or wash.
